15. The Hurricane Heist

Entertainment Studios Motion Pictures

RottenTomatoes Score: 46% (4.8/10)

Box Office: Despite the obvious kitschy appeal of its premise and a moderate $35 million price tag, the lack of major star power clearly hurt this one, as it opened to less than half of initial projections, and to date has only barely recouped one-third of its budget.

Verdict: You have to give this movie some measure of credit: it knows exactly what it is, has no pretensions otherwise, and basically delivers the idiotic thrills its audience demands.

Sure, the set-pieces look painfully low budget - especially the hilarious PS2-era CGI - and the family narrative is boring as hell, but it really hits its stride in act three, with every remaining cent having clearly been splashed onto the screen.

It's a little lethargic at times, but honestly, far more in on the joke than you might've initially given it credit for.
